Just got my amazon kindle and I'm really into it. I have so far read the Vault of Walt and JC's Guide to the Magic Kingdom. Vault of Walt was good but kinda all over the place. I really liked some of it, but found myself skipping chapters. JC's guide was more of a beginners guide, but it still had some good info. I'm one of those people who have to be constantly reading or listening to something Disney. It was less than $1.50 so it was fair enough.

Anyway those are my reviews, what do you guys recommend?
